Which of the following OOAD artifacts can be effectively used to organize a project team’s
responsibilities?
A.
Activity diagrams, because they identify areas of parallel development.
B.
Use cases, because they drive the development process.
C.
Package diagrams, because they represent a logical partitioning of the conceptual model.
D.
Deployment diagrams, because they correspond to the different layers of the software
architecture.